- the invention relates to a cutlery drawer for a dishwasher, with a drawer body which is mounted so that it can be pulled out of a washing compartment of the dishwasher in the pull-out direction and which provides a cutlery insert for holding cutlery items, the cutlery insert having a first row of cams as well as a first row of cams for individually receiving cutlery items aligned transversely to the pull-out direction
- Row of cams has a second row of cams running parallel and arranged at a distance therefrom, each row of cams having a plurality of cams arranged one behind the other in the extension direction, with adjacent cams per row of cams being arranged at a distance from one another with the respective formation of a gap.
- Cutlery drawers of the generic type are well known from the prior art, which is why separate printed evidence is not required at this point. Reference should therefore only be made, as an example, to EP 3409 182 A1 and EP 3 025 628 A1, which each disclose generic cutlery drawers.
- a generic cutlery drawer has a frame-like drawer body which provides a cutlery insert or several cutlery inserts to accommodate cutlery items.
- the drawer body is designed to be movable together with the cutlery insert received therefrom or with the cutlery inserts received therefrom in the pull-out direction out of the washing compartment of the dishwasher or movable into it.
- cams arranged in rows are provided, with adjacent cams being spaced apart from one another to form a gap.
- the space formed between two adjacent cams accommodates a piece of cutlery in sections.
- two rows of cams are preferably provided, which are arranged next to one another transversely to the pull-out direction of the cutlery drawer, with the cams of a cam row each extending one behind the other in the pull-out direction.
- the known construction allows the user to equip the cutlery drawer with individual pieces of cutlery in a simple manner.
- the cutlery parts are each arranged between two adjacent cams of a row of cams and aligned transversely, preferably orthogonally, to the pull-out direction of the cutlery drawer.
- the object on which the invention is based is to further develop a generic cutlery drawer structurally in such a way that the user can easily use the storage capacity provided by the cutlery drawer in an optimized manner.
- the invention proposes a cutlery drawer of the type mentioned, which is characterized in that two adjacent cams of the first row of cams and two adjacent cams of the second row of cams are provided by a common support element, the support element being perpendicular to the extension direction rotating axis of rotation is arranged on the cutlery insert so that it can be rotated by at least 90 °.
- the cutlery drawer according to the invention has a support element which carries adjacent cams of the two rows of cams, ie at least two adjacent cams of the first row of cams and at least two adjacent cams of the second row of cams.
- the support element preferably has 2 to 10, in particular 4 to 8 cams each first and second cam ranges.
- the support element can be rotated on the user side, namely by at least 90 ° about an axis of rotation that runs perpendicular to the pull-out direction, in particular perpendicular to the receiving plane of the cutlery insert. It is therefore permitted to position the cams provided by the support element in particular transversely in relation to the remaining cams of the two rows of cams, which allows the formation of a respective gap in the rows of cams.
- the design according to the invention allows the cutlery drawer to be equipped more flexibly, with conventionally designed cutlery parts being positioned in the usual manner transversely to the pull-out direction in their geometric design.
- the support element provided according to the invention can be rotated so that gaps are created in the rows of cams in the manner described above, which enables larger pieces of cutlery to be accommodated there.
- the support element has a bearing pin which engages in a counter contour on the cutlery insert side.
- the support element is rotatably arranged on the cutlery insert.
- the axis of rotation results in accordance with the design of the bearing pin transversely to the extension direction, that is to say in the height direction of the dishwasher.
- the bearing pin interacts with a counter contour on the cutlery insert side, which allows a safe rotational movement of the support element when used as intended.
- the support element has a latching device which is designed to secure the position of the support element on the cutlery insert in the direction of the axis of rotation.
- the locking device provided according to the invention ensures a precise and secure arrangement of the support element on the cutlery insert, in the direction of the axis of rotation, that is, in the height direction of the dishwasher. This ensures a captive arrangement of the support element on the cutlery insert when used as intended, so that the support element cannot detach from the cutlery insert in an unintentional manner. This ensures safe handling of the cutlery drawer, including the support element arranged on it.
- the support element has a locking device which is designed to secure the position of the support element on the cutlery insert in the direction of rotation.
- the locking device provided according to the invention ensures that an unwanted twisting movement of the support element in the direction of rotation is prevented.
- the locking device secures the support element in the position specified by the user in relation to the cutlery insert.
- the locking can take place continuously, but also in stages, with it being preferred according to the invention to provide at least two rotational positions. In the first rotational position of the support element, the cams provided by it are aligned in the direction of the rows of cams of the cutlery insert, so that closed rows of cams are achieved. In this position, the cutlery drawer can be equipped in the usual way.
- the support element In a second position of the support element, it is rotated by 90° to the starting position, in which the cams provided by the support element are aligned transversely to the extension direction. In this position, the rows of cams are therefore interrupted due to the twisted support element due to the gaps that form. The gaps formed in this way in the rows of cams can also be used to accommodate larger pieces of cutlery in the manner already described.
- the support element In both previously described rotational positions of the support element in relation to the cutlery insert, according to the locking device according to the invention, the support element is preferably locked relative to the cutlery insert, so that unwanted rotation of the support element in both possible positions is prevented.
- the locking device on the one hand and the locking device on the other hand ensure that the support element is arranged as a whole in a precisely positioned and secure position on the cutlery insert, namely in all intended possible rotational positions.
- the support element has a ring body, which carries a plurality of bearing pins evenly distributed over the circumference of a circular ring or the ring body on the cutlery insert side.
- the support element has not only one bearing pin, but also several bearing pins, preferably four bearing pins. These bearing pins are arranged on an annular body of the support element.
- the ring body can, for example, itself be designed like a ring, in particular rotationally symmetrical to the axis of rotation of the support element, and the bearing pins can be equally distributed over the circumference of the ring body.
- the ring body can also have a different geometry, i.e. it cannot itself be designed like a ring, as long as the bearing pins carried by it are arranged evenly distributed over the circumference of a circular ring lying perpendicular to the axis of rotation of the support element. This ensures safe guidance of the support element relative to the cutlery insert and also enables an evenly distributed application of force, which simplifies proper handling. Furthermore, this preferred embodiment ensures simplified assembly and disassembly in the event of repairs.
- each bearing pin is designed to be resiliently pivotable in the radial direction of the ring body and has a locking extension extending away from the ring body in the radial direction of the ring body, for example outwards.
- the bearing pins are designed to be resiliently pivotable in the radial direction of the ring body.
- simplified assembly is made possible because the bearing pins pivot to the side when a support element is correctly inserted into the counter contour of the cutlery insert and are transferred back to their starting position when the end position of the ring body is reached.
- the locking extensions provided on the bearing pin side engage behind the counter contour of the cutlery insert, so that the support element is locked on the cutlery insert in the direction of the axis of rotation in the manner already described.
- the counter contour on the cutlery insert side is positioned for each bearing pin between the ring body on the one hand and the locking extension on the other.
- the cutlery insert has a support ring which interacts with the ring body of the support element and on which the bearing pins of the support element rest on the inner circumference in the finally assembled state.
- the cutlery insert side counter contour for the support element is formed by a support ring.
- the ring body of the support element rests on this support ring in the finally assembled state, with the bearing pins arranged on the ring body engaging behind it with the locking extensions on the bearing pin side.
- the support ring therefore serves, on the one hand, to arrange the support element in a secure position, but also provides the running surface on which the ring body of the support element is guided when it is rotated as intended.
- the support ring has a locking groove on the inside circumference.
- This locking groove is part of the locking device according to the invention and serves to secure the position of the support element in the direction of rotation in relation to the cutlery insert.
- the support element has a locking extension which interacts with the locking groove of the support ring.
- the locking extension is also part of the locking device according to the invention, which, when used as intended, interacts with the locking groove of the support ring. In a locked position of the support element, the locking extension of the support element engages in the associated locking groove of the support ring. This ensures that the position is secured in the direction of rotation.
- the support element has two longitudinal webs arranged on the ring body, one longitudinal web carrying the two cams of the first row of cams and the other longitudinal web carrying the two cams of the second row of cams.
- the longitudinal webs In the non-rotated basic position, the longitudinal webs extend in the direction of the two rows of cams on the cutlery insert side. Because of this, the cams carried by the longitudinal webs are arranged in the row of cams, which means that the rows of cams can be used in a conventional manner.
- the support element has two Ring body arranged and the two longitudinal webs each connecting transverse webs.
- the result is a rectangular configuration or arrangement of the longitudinal webs on the one hand and the transverse webs on the other hand.
- the webs surround the ring body, which serves to rotatably mount the support element in the manner described above.
- the result is a very simple structure for the support element, which on the one hand ensures a robust arrangement of the cams and, on the other hand, allows the possibility of the previously described twisting movement of the support element.
- a crossbar carries a separating means on its side facing the cam.
- a separating means can serve to provide additional support for a piece of cutlery held by the support element when used as intended.
- the crossbar can also be designed without any separating means.
- it is preferred to provide a separating means because this ensures that a piece of cutlery that is picked up occupies a defined position. This results in an optimized cleaning result when used as intended.
- a separating means can serve, for example, to divide the otherwise free side of a transverse web into two individual receiving sections, so that contact surfaces, e.g. Sloping contact surfaces are provided for a piece of cutlery to be supported.
- the separating means can also be arranged off-center on the crossbar, so that two differently sized receiving sections are provided.
- the invention further proposes a dishwasher with a cutlery drawer according to the invention.
- the advantages mentioned above arise for a dishwasher equipped in this way.

- Fig. 1 shows a dishwasher 1 according to the invention in a purely schematic side view.
- this has a housing 2 which accommodates a washing container 3.
- the washing container 3 in turn provides a washing space 4 for holding items to be cleaned.
- the washing compartment 4 is accessible via a loading opening 5. This can be closed in a fluid-tight manner by means of a washing compartment door 6 which is pivotably arranged on the housing 2.
- the dishwasher 1 has a spray device 7 for loading the items to be cleaned with washing liquid.
- This spray device 7 has via a plurality of rotatably arranged spray arms, with two spray arms 8 and 9 being shown in the exemplary embodiment shown.
- Washware carriers are used to hold items to be cleaned, with a cutlery drawer 10, an upper basket 11 and a lower basket 12 being provided in the exemplary embodiment shown.
- the upper basket 11 is arranged above the lower basket 12 in the height direction 13 and the cutlery drawer 10 is located above the upper basket 11 in the height direction 13.
- the upper basket 11 and the lower basket 12 With items to be washed, they can be moved out of the washing compartment 4 of the dishwasher 1 on the user side in the pull-out direction 18.
- the cutlery drawer 10, the upper basket 11 and the lower basket 12 are mounted so that they can be pulled out of the washing compartment 4 of the dishwasher 1 in the pull-out direction 18.
- the cutlery drawer 10 is designed in accordance with the invention, as can be seen from the further figures. 2 to 11 results.
- FIG. 2 shows first of all that the cutlery drawer 10 has a drawer body 14 which is designed like a frame.
- This drawer body 14 carries a total of three cutlery inserts 15, 16 and 17, with the cutlery insert 16 being arranged transversely to the pull-out direction 18 between the two cutlery inserts 15 and 17.
- the two cutlery inserts 15 and 17 each have rows of cams running in the pull-out direction 18, namely a first row of cams 19 and a second row of cams 20, as shown by way of example using the cutlery insert 17 in FIG.
- Each row of cams 19 and 20 each has cams 21 and 22, which are arranged one behind the other in the extension direction 18, with a gap 23 being formed between adjacent cams 21 and 22.
- cams 19 and 20 serve in a manner known per se to pick up cutlery items individually, namely oriented transversely to the pull-out direction, as can be seen in FIG. 8 using knives 36 as cutlery items.
- At least two (in the exemplary embodiment shown There are only, for example, five) adjacent cams 21 of the first row of cams 19 and at least two (in the exemplary embodiment shown there are only five as an example) adjacent cams 22 of the second row of cams 20 are provided by a common support element 24, as is shown in a synopsis of the detailed views according to FIGS . 3 and 4 can be seen.
- a support element 24 is arranged on the cutlery insert 17 so that it can be rotated by 90 ° about an axis of rotation that runs perpendicular to the pull-out direction 18, in particular perpendicular to the receiving plane of the cutlery insert 17. This factual connection can be seen in FIG. 5, with the support element 24 on the right in FIG. 5 being in the normal position, whereas the support element 24 on the left in FIG. 5 is rotated by 90° in relation to the cutlery insert 17.
- a support element 24 has an annular body 25.
- this annular body 25 carries four bearing pins 28, which extend downwards from the annular body 25 with respect to the height direction 13.
- the bearing pins 28 are arranged on the ring body 25 in a resiliently pivotable manner in the radial direction of the ring body.
- Each bearing pin 28 has a locking extension 29 remote from the ring body, which extends outwards in the radial direction of the ring body 25.
- the ring body 25 and the bearing pins 28 arranged thereon rest against a corresponding counter contour of the cutlery insert 17.
- This counter contour of the cutlery insert 17 is formed by a support ring 33, as can be seen from a top view of the cutlery insert 17 in FIG.
- the ring body 25 of a support element 24 rests on the associated support ring 33 of the cutlery insert 17.
- the bearing pins 28 rest on the inner circumference of the support ring 33, with the locking extensions 29 on the bearing pin side engaging under the support ring 33.
- the support ring 33 is thus arranged in the final assembled state between the ring body 25 of a support element 24 and the locking extensions 29 of the associated bearing pins 28. This ensures a secure locking of the support element 24 on the cutlery insert 17, with the support element 24 being positioned securely on the cutlery insert 17 in the direction of the axis of rotation.
- Support element 24 also has longitudinal webs 26 and transverse webs 27.
- the longitudinal webs 26 as well as the transverse webs 27 are arranged on the ring body 25, specifically in the exemplary embodiment shown with the interposition of spacer webs.
- the transverse webs 27 connect the longitudinal webs 26 to one another in such a way that a rectangular configuration is achieved with regard to the longitudinal webs 26 on the one hand and the transverse webs 27 on the other hand.
- the longitudinal webs 26 carry the cams 21 and 22 provided by the support element 24 on the upper side.
- the transverse webs 27 are, however, optionally equipped with a separating means 35.
- a locking device is used to secure the position of the support element 24 in the direction of rotation
- this has a locking extension 31 on the support element side and a locking groove on the cutlery insert side
- the locking extension 31 interacts with one of the four locking grooves 34 depending on the rotational position of the support element 24. In the locked state, the locking extension 31 engages in the associated locking groove 34, which prevents an unwanted twisting movement of the support element 24 in relation to the cutlery insert 17,
- a support element 24 can, as can be seen from the already explained FIG. 5, be rotated in relation to the cutlery insert 17.
- the support element 24 can be transferred from a normal position to a twisted position and vice versa.
- the rows of cams can be equipped with cutlery items in a conventional manner, the cutlery items in this case being aligned transversely to the pull-out direction 18, as can be seen from the knives 36 in FIG.
- a support element 24 can optionally be equipped with a separating means 35 already described above.
- separating means 35 different embodiments are conceivable, as can be seen in a synopsis of FIGS. 9 and 10 shows using different exemplary embodiments.
- a separating means 35 basically serves to divide the otherwise free side of a crossbar into individual receiving sections, so that contact surfaces are provided for a piece of cutlery 37 to be supported.
- the design according to the invention enables more flexible and space-optimized equipping of the cutlery drawer
- the rotatable arrangement of the support elements 24 according to the invention allows larger cutlery items to be accommodated in the cutlery drawer 10 transversely to the pull-out direction 18, so that an alignment of a larger cutlery item in the pull-out direction 18, as shown by way of example in FIG. 8, is not necessary. This advantageously does not hinder the transverse alignment of other cutlery items, so that the holding capacity provided by the cutlery drawer 10 can also be optimally utilized in the intended manner.
